The Google Pixel 2 already has a release date and will arrive with Snapdragon 836

Google Pixel 2

The Google Pixel 2 will be made by HTC and will feature the latest Android operating system of all, Android 8.0 Oreo, and now we also know when it should be officially unveiled.

The release date of the Google Pixel 2 was confirmed by Evan Blass On twitter. Blass is one of the most trusted sources for mobile and device launches. One of the latest news shared with his followers was that The Pixel 2 will also have the Qualcomm Snapdragon 836 processor.

The event dedicated to the Google Pixel 2 will take place on October 5, which means that it will arrive after the big launches this fall, but before the presentation of the Huawei Mate 10. The most interesting thing is that the date of October 5, 2017 falls just one year and one day after the presentation of the first Pixel.

Regarding the technical specifications of the mobile, it is possible that the Google Pixel 2 offers 6 GB of RAM, a space of 64 GB for storage data and an improved still camera.

Like last year, it is expected that there will be two models of the mobile. The XL version could bring a screen 6-inch QuadHD, while the smallest would remain in the 5 inches with a Full HD resolution.

Among other things, the Google Pixel 2 will likely be the first new smartphone this year to have the Android 8 Oreo operating system, although since this month Google already offers the new platform for the first generation of Google Pixel and the Nexus.

As good as the Google Pixel 2 is, it will still have the same problem as its predecessor, specifically the issue of distribution. The previous model was available in the United States, but the Pixel XL had limited stock, while in Europe it could only be purchased from the United Kingdom thanks to an agreement with the United States.
